Chapter 64 Make a Choice Today
I just wanted to bail ASAP, like someone standing by the ocean with a tsunami coming in. One second too long and I'd be toast. Arthur's car was just a hop away. But as soon as I grabbed the door handle, a bandaged hand slammed it shut. My heart dropped.
Arthur was already in the driver's seat, not even budging.
Ethan was leaning against the car, one hand in his pocket.
I didn't dare look up; my eyes were glued to Ethan's injured hand.
"Emily, I'm not one to beat around the bush. You can hop in his car or mine. Make your call today, and whatever you pick, I'll roll with it." Ethan's voice was chill, like it was no biggie, but to me, it felt like the world was ending.
I almost caved and walked over to Ethan. But then I remembered his games, remembered Fiona he couldn't let go of, and Victor's words that made me feel like dirt. I couldn't bring myself to get close to him. Since we couldn't be a thing, I had to cut it off before it got messier.
I tried to open the car door again, but Ethan was still leaning on it, blocking me.
He didn't budge, just stood there, but I saw his bandaged hand clench into a fist, blood seeping through.
"Made up your mind?" His voice turned icy, losing its calm.
I took a deep breath, forced myself to look at him. "Yeah."
I thought he'd blow up, but he didn't. He just smirked. "Alright."
I almost lost my balance, but I kept it together, trying not to show any emotion.
Ethan slowly pulled out a cigarette, lighting it up. "Then let's set a date to finalize the divorce."
I swallowed hard, my throat tasting like metal. "Okay."
His hand holding the cigarette froze for a sec. Then he switched it to his bandaged hand, reached into his pocket, and pulled out a pearl necklace.
I knew it; it was the one we sent for repair last time.
"Guess this is trash now." The next second, the necklace flew from his hand, landing perfectly in a nearby trash can.
My heart ached. I knew what he was gonna do the moment he raised his hand. I even wanted to grab it from him, but I didn't.
After tossing the necklace, Ethan turned and walked away, leaving me with his cold, indifferent back.
But my eyes were stuck on the bandage on his hand, the red spreading fast. I wasn't squeamish about blood, but my heart hurt, and I felt dizzy.
